In this musical improvisation workshop, Oran Etkin draws on his experiences working with master musicians from around the world—including Africa, Indonesia, New Orleans, and the Middle East—to offer many diverse inspirations.
We listen to recordings by great weavers of melodies from different genres to see how a beautiful tune can grow from the seed of a two- or three-note motif. We also explore the power of groove and the playfulness of rhythm within it. Best of all, we make music together, deepening our connection to ourselves, each other, and our surroundings.
Etkin shows us how to trust our musical intuition, responding to what we hear and creating music in the moment without letting critical thoughts interfere.
This musical improvisation workshop is open to seasoned professionals, dedicated students, and novice music lovers eager to make music for the first time.
